Market Close: Benchmark indices registered a strong recovery from the intraday lows and ended on a positive note on August 2 with Nifty finished a tad below 11,000 mark.


At close the Sensex was up 118.69 points at 37,137.01, while Nifty was up 17.40 points at 10,997.40. About 1104 shares have advanced, 1339 shares declined, and 132 shares are unchanged. 

Indiabulls Housing, Tata Steel, SBI, Coal India and Wipro were among major losers on the Nifty, while gainers include Bharti Airtel, Asian Paints, Eicher Motors, Bajaj Auto and Maruti Suzuki.

HDFC Q1 net profit jumps 46%:

Housing Development Finance Corporation (HDFC) has reported 46 percent jump in its Q1FY20 net profit at Rs 3,203.10 crore against Rs 2,190 in the same quarter last year.

Revenue of the company was up 30.6 percent at Rs 12,990.29 crore against Rs 9,947.35 crore.

SBI Q1 results:

State Bank of India (SBI) has reported Q1 net profit at Rs 2,312 crore, net interest income (NII) at Rs 22,939 crore. Net NPA was up marginally at 3.07 percent, while gross NPA unchanged at 7.53 percent, QoQ.
